Executive Summary
The City of Bayonne, NJ, is actively seeking qualifications and proposals from a professional engineering and environmental consulting firm to serve as its Redevelopment & Environmental Program Manager. This critical role involves acting as the City's principal consultant, responsible for managing both internal and external engineering and environmental professional efforts. The comprehensive scope of work includes supporting capital improvements, planning and implementing the Long Term Control Plan, ensuring environmental compliance, overseeing redevelopment planning and implementation, securing grant funding, facilitating open space improvements, and developing climate change resiliency strategies. The selected firm will be instrumental in collaborating with various City departments, including Planning/Zoning, Police, Fire, Building, Public Works, Law, Procurement, and Municipal Services, to advance Bayonne's redevelopment and environmental objectives, creating substantial value for the municipality.
Prospective contractors must meet stringent qualification criteria to be considered for this professional services engagement. A minimum of ten years of experience providing consulting services to municipalities with populations exceeding 60,000, demonstrating expertise in improvement projects, road programs, utility upgrades, public building enhancements, recreational facilities, land surveying, and mapping, is mandatory. The firm must be certified to provide engineering services in New Jersey and possess experience in obtaining permits and approvals from state, county, and local regulatory agencies. Furthermore, the successful respondent is required to maintain a staff of New Jersey licensed or certified professionals, including civil engineers, land surveyors, planners, environmental consultants, and construction administrators. Project managers must have at least ten years of municipal experience, and the firm should have a principal office in close proximity to Bayonne for prompt response to emergent matters. Mandatory insurance coverages include Worker’s Compensation, General Liability ($2,000,000 per occurrence / $5,000,000 aggregate), Automotive Liability ($1,000,000 / $2,000,000 aggregate), Professional Liability ($1,000,000 per occurrence), and Environmental Liability ($2,000,000 per occurrence / $5,000,000 aggregate), with the City of Bayonne named as an additional insured.
